Hey guys/gals this is my first post on here... I have a 2004 Honda Accord with a 3.0 vtec motor...recently I lost all heat and no heated seats in my car...I have checked every fuse and relay in the car and they still do not work...any ideas on what I should try to look for next? The lights on the buttons don't even turn on and I can't get the blower motor to turn on...thanks for anyone who can help...

Start with under-dash fuse no. 30. This fuse should have power running through it with the ignition switch in the ON (II) position. You do not need to start the car for the test. Report your result. We can try to narrow down the area of the issue.

Thank you tech8 for that. That was the first thing I went to and looked at. Sure enough...there was not a fuse there what so ever...no idea how that happened....so I went to advanced auto store and bought fuses. Put a 7.5 amp fuse in. And it all works....thank you so much for your help
